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"regular formation"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a consistent or standard arrangement or structure in various contexts, such as military, sports, or academic settings. Example: "The team practiced their regular formation before the big game to ensure everyone knew their positions."

FAQs
How can I use "regular formation" in a sentence?
You can use "regular formation" to describe a consistent arrangement, such as "The soldiers marched in "regular formation"" or "The crystals exhibited a "regular formation" under the microscope".
What are some alternatives to "regular formation"?
Some alternatives to "regular formation" include "standard configuration", "typical arrangement", or "consistent structure", depending on the specific context.
Is it better to say "regular formation" or "uniform formation"?
Both "regular formation" and "uniform formation" are correct, but "uniform formation" emphasizes the identical nature of the elements, while "regular formation" focuses on the consistency of the arrangement.
In what contexts is "regular formation" commonly used?
"Regular formation" is commonly used in contexts such as military, sports, science, and manufacturing to describe consistent arrangements, structures, or patterns.
